The Settlement Process

Many times, a truck accident attorney would attempt to settle these cases pre-suit after all the medical bills and lost wages are gathered. A lawyer will usually send a demand package to the insurance carrier and attempt to settle the case in good faith.

Often, a fruitful negotiation process occurs, and a lawyer will able to settle the case without filing a lawsuit. But if the insurance carriers are not willing to settle the case for fair value, then a lawyer would encourage the claimant to file a lawsuit. Filing a lawsuit would help the claimant get the justice they deserve in the form of compensation.

After filing, the case would go into the litigation process, and through that, an attorney will still attempt to settle these cases in mediation and prior to a lawsuit, but it ultimately may go to a jury to determine what the judgment will be on the case.

How Is a Settlement Value Calculated?

Each case is different, but individuals may be able to recover compensation for their damages. Often a multiplier is used with the medical expenses and non-economic damages. The settlement takes into consideration the injured party’s economic losses, which are their medical bills, property damage, and lost income, in addition to their non-economic damages, which could be pain and suffering, loss of consortium, and loss of enjoyment of life. Sharing Liability For an Accident

In Texas, as long as the injured party is no more than 50 percent at fault for the crash, then they can still make a claim. If the claimant is found to be more than 50 percent at fault, then they will be unable to recover compensation for damages.
